In the 1881 Census, the household of James J Hendry, born in 1849 in Kirkintilloch, Dunbartonshire, consisted of 5 members. James J was the head of the household, married to Annie Hendry, born in 1853 in Kelso, Roxburghshire, Scotland. They had 1 child; William, born 1879 in Glasgow, Lanarkshire, Scotland.
During the period, also present in the household were James J's Mother, Janet (born 1821 in Glasgow, Lanarkshire, Scotland) and James J's Cousin, Jessie (born 1867 in Kirkintilloch, Dunbartonshire, Scotland).
